Posted
vor 2 Stunden schrieb Siema:

I think it has something to do with the new fog system

Yes when you enable fog, no matter how dense, it will be at least Case II.

 

Weird thing: Every other mission I open afterwards will also have Case II, even if it was Case I before and perfect wheather. If I close DCS and restart the mission it will be Case I again. So basically if I enable fog, every mission afterwards, no matter the condition, will be Case II or III until I restart DCS.
